Constraint Handling Methods for Management Systems of Pavement Maintenance and Rehabilitation
首发时间:2008-10-02
Abstract:The rate of good level highway in the network is the most important evaluation criteria on the pavement maintenance and rehabilitation quality in China. In this paper, we propose two discrete optimization models in different rate of good level highway constraint handling Methods. These optimal decision models are formulated as linear integer programming problems with binary decision variables. The objective function and constraints are based on the pavement performance and prediction model using the Pavement Condition Index (PCI). Numerical experiments are carried out with the data from a highway system in Sichuan Province.
